Class: Ovec::VerbatimNode
Instance Method Summary collapse
-
#initialize(command, delimiter, content) ⇒ VerbatimNode
constructor
A new instance of VerbatimNode.
- #left_delimiter ⇒ Object
- #right_delimiter ⇒ Object
- #to_tex ⇒ Object
Constructor Details
#initialize(command, delimiter, content) ⇒ VerbatimNode
Returns a new instance of VerbatimNode.
36 37 38 39 40 |
# File 'lib/ovec/nodes.rb', line 36 def initialize(command, delimiter, content) @command = command @delimiter = delimiter @content = content end |
Instance Method Details
#left_delimiter ⇒ Object
42 43 44 |
# File 'lib/ovec/nodes.rb', line 42 def left_delimiter @delimiter end |
#right_delimiter ⇒ Object
46 47 48 |
# File 'lib/ovec/nodes.rb', line 46 def right_delimiter Parser.delimiter_right_side @delimiter end |
#to_tex ⇒ Object
50 51 52 |
# File 'lib/ovec/nodes.rb', line 50 def to_tex "\\#@command#{left_delimiter}#@content#{right_delimiter}" end |